Output 5fa62c80e0e699cc37500f2619b61a39768b590b11a8ee0ac84351833ac58718:2

value
14251784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95268c2104578eb94c303a74411e9773d636474 OP_EQUAL
address
MSFemt2BB6HPDwgCdjKy6LSfH6A5Lqsr3y
transaction
5fa62c80e0e699cc37500f2619b61a39768b590b11a8ee0ac84351833ac58718
spent
true